Abstract
The methods of jointed rock mass investigation in open pit mining are reviewed. The modern software routines of jointing modeling are analyzed. An approach to 3D modeling of a production block is proposed and tested; the approach integrates the strength characteristics of rocks from the data on energy content of drilling and the simplified mathematical model of joints, including tectonic faults. The model is implemented in the Python language and using Surfer data visualization tool. The prospects for the further research include experimental verification of the model and development of a related program module for drill-and-blast design in open pit mining.
